Mei Mei Restaurant
Chinese · Restaurant
884 Washington St, 02062 NorwoodChinese · Restaurant
884 Washington St, 02062 NorwoodRestaurant · Pizzeria
884 Washington St, 02062 NorwoodDelicatessen and gourmet · Restaurant · Café
734 Washington St, 02062 NorwoodRestaurant
20 Central St, 02062 NorwoodRestaurant
728 Washington St, 02062 NorwoodDelicatessen and gourmet · Restaurant
734 Washington St, 02062 NorwoodRestaurant
716 Washington St, 02062 NorwoodRestaurant · Pizzeria
20 Central St, 02062 NorwoodRestaurant
711 Washington St, 02062 NorwoodRestaurant · Pizzeria
52 Broadway, 02062 NorwoodRestaurant
58 Broadway, 02062 NorwoodRestaurant · Pizzeria · Delivery service · Italian language · Pasta
56 Broadway, 02062 NorwoodRestaurant · Pizzeria
1023 Washington St, 02062 NorwoodRestaurant
678 Washington St, 02062 NorwoodRestaurant
89 Central St, 02062 NorwoodRestaurant
9 Vernon St, 02062 NorwoodRestaurant
32 Broadway, 02062 NorwoodRestaurant · Fast Food
75 Cottage St E, 02062 NorwoodRestaurant
89 Central St, 02062 NorwoodRestaurant
111 Lenox St, 02062 Norwood